Silo Demolition Services in Waycross, Ware County

Georgia's agricultural heritage includes hundreds of grain silos, feed storage towers, and bulk material silos on farms, feed mills, and agricultural processing facilities throughout the state's farming counties. As agricultural operations consolidate and modernize, older concrete and steel silos reach the end of their useful lives and require professional demolition. Georgia Demolition & Removal has extensive experience demolishing agricultural silos across south Georgia's farm belt, middle Georgia's commodity processing centers, and industrial silos at cement plants and batch facilities throughout the state.

Silo Demolition Costs in Waycross, GA

Most projects range from $2,500 to $25,000 depending on structure size, materials, site access, and hazardous-material handling. We provide a detailed written estimate after a free on-site assessment.

Structure size & scope

Larger silo demolition projects require more labor, equipment hours, and disposal capacity.

Materials & construction

Concrete, masonry, steel, and mixed materials each change demolition method and haul-away cost.

Site access

Tight urban lots or remote Georgia sites affect equipment mobilization and staging.

Hazardous materials

Asbestos or lead paint abatement adds licensed-survey and disposal requirements.
